    Loosing 10lbs of fat won´t take away his chin. He struggled with Arreola because he doesn´t train at all. It was his first fight in 17 months.
    There was a long period where Ruiz would consistently weighed in below 260, heck he even managed below 250 at times.
    But this changed in 2019 and since then Ruiz has had the idea that he can just weigh whatever he wants and perform at his best.

    :lol: I still remember several idiots here claiming the heavier Ruiz is, the easier he will beat Joshua in the rematch. Well, he weighed 15lbs more and got schooled. Joshua quite literally ran circles around him, with ease.
